Silent Retreats

Would you like to spend some time apart to be with God, to hear Him, with plenty of peace and quiet?

Lee Abbey offers the freedom and space for you to do so. We also offer particular weeks with reflective teaching and periods of silence.

What does the daily programme entail?

There will be a balanced programme of worship, daily addresses, walks, opportunities for creativity and time for prayer and reading. However, there is no pressure to join in with anything. You are free to do as much or as little as you would like.

How much guidance will I receive?

The guest speaker will give talks or reflections each day, which we hope will help you seek God. The Lee Abbey Pastoral Team will also be available to talk and pray with you, if you would like to.

What if I can't cope with being silent?

All retreats include periods of silence as well as opportunities for talking. On "silent days", all the meals will be in silence with light background music. Apart from mealtimes, the silence is not compulsory and you are free to talk. We only ask that you respect the silence in the main areas of the House and do not disturb other guests. Many guests find that they come closer to others in the silence, and that is often reflected in the conversations after the silent period.

Individually guided retreats

We occasionally offer the ability to do an individually guided retreat, with one hour per day with a guide. These retreats happen on quieter Monday-Friday weeks when other guests are here, and are limited in number. See the programme for details of when these are.
